Dog Gone Love DVD Summary
The direct-to-DVD
romantic comedy
Dog Gone Love
is the tale of two dog lovers, bookish author
Steven
(
Alexander Chaplin
) and assistant veterinarian
Rebecca
(
Lindsay Sloane
).
Upon meeting
Steven
,
Rebecca
makes the assumption that he is gay.
Steven
allows her to go on believing this so that he can use her expertise in all things canine to research his latest novel -- and besides, he thinks she's cute.
